Transaction 51661e6ecc7952b9d44d1d6de750bb549558fc9b10f45e981512b92fa7197987
1 Input
2 Outputs
- 51661e6ecc7952b9d44d1d6de750bb549558fc9b10f45e981512b92fa7197987:0
- 51661e6ecc7952b9d44d1d6de750bb549558fc9b10f45e981512b92fa7197987:1
value 52241
address 33hJneUYLcrQfgEQ3EofzHAn9P7VCif2Df
value 778749
address 14d3ndP6mjV5FAdKoWLAZwX1mGzF34ogXo